Winners of NEAHMA Poster Contest

Braintree, MA — Peabody Properties, Inc. has announced the winners of the 2026 New England Affordable Housing Management Association (NEAHMA) Poster Contest. This year, 19 entries were submitted from nine Peabody properties, with several advancing to the regional NEAHMA round and five moving on to the national NAHMA round of judging.

The contest, themed “Shaping Our Future: Building Stronger Communities Together,” was open to children, elderly, and special needs residents living in a NAHMA community. A panel of judges selected the winning entries in each category.

Asterisked names indicate those artists whose posters were submitted to NEAHMA for the regional round of judging; the five italicized entries indicate those sent to NAHMA for national judging.
